    Birt , n. [OE. byrte; cf. F. bertonneau. Cf. Bret, Burt.] (Zool.) A fish of the turbot kind; the brill. [Written also burt, bret, or brut.] [Prov. Eng.]
    1913 Webster
  2.       
    
    Burt , n. (Zool.) See Birt. [Prov. Eng.]
